The blood flow throughout the body is primarily controlled by the autonomic nervous system, which consists of the sympathetic and parasympathetic nervous systems. These systems regulate blood vessel constriction and dilation to adjust blood flow based on the body's needs. Hormones such as adrenaline and noradrenaline also play a role in controlling blood flow through their effects on blood vessels.
